Grind Quality Consistency
Achieving consistent grind quality is vital for making great espresso, as fluctuations in grind size can lead to over- or under-extraction, ruining the flavor and crema. Burr grinders are preferred because they produce more uniform particles than blade grinders, improving extraction consistency. Many machines offer multiple grind settings—preferably 15 or more—giving precise control over particle size to suit different brewing styles. Regular cleaning and calibration are essential; dirt or misalignment can cause uneven grounds or clogs, compromising consistency. Digital or mechanical grind adjustment systems help guarantee repeatable settings, shot after shot. Ultimately, a grinder that maintains stable grind size enables reliable extraction, ensuring each cup delivers the rich flavor and crema that define barista-quality espresso.

Maintenance Requirements
Since regular maintenance is essential for keeping an espresso machine with a built-in grinder performing at its best, I always prioritize models that make cleaning straightforward. Regular descaling and cleaning of the grinder and brewing components prevent blockages and maintain flavor quality. Many machines require weekly cleaning of burrs, water tanks, and drip trays to guarantee hygiene and longevity. Using dedicated cleaning tablets or solutions helps remove oil buildup and mineral deposits that can affect taste and machine function. Some models feature automatic cleaning cycles or removable parts, which simplify maintenance routines and reduce manual effort. Proper upkeep of the burrs and thorough flushing of the water system are vital for consistent grind quality and ideal extraction. Easy maintenance can save time and keep your machine working like new.

Built-in Grinder Options
Built-in grinders come with a variety of options that can substantially influence your espresso experience. Most offer multiple grind settings, often between 10 and 31, giving you precise control over particle size. The quality of the burr grinder is vital; conical burrs are usually preferred for consistency and better flavor extraction. Many machines feature adjustable grind size, whether via a dial or digital controls, allowing customization for different beans and brewing styles. Additionally, some machines include dosing features that automatically measure the right amount of coffee grounds, helping guarantee consistency shot to shot. Regular maintenance, such as cleaning and replacing burrs, is essential to keep the grinder performing at its best. Choosing the right grinder options can make a significant difference in your espresso’s quality.
Price and Budget
Choosing the right espresso machine with a built-in grinder largely depends on your budget. These machines can range from about $150 to over $1,500, with prices reflecting features, build quality, and technology. Setting a clear budget helps narrow your options, so you don’t overspend on unnecessary extras or settle for lower quality. Higher-priced models often offer more durable construction, advanced features, and better customization, which can enhance your brewing experience. On the other hand, budget-friendly options might lack some precision in grinding and brewing controls, potentially affecting the final taste. By considering your overall budget, you can find a machine that strikes a good balance between affordability and performance, ensuring you get the best value for your money.
